MongoDB-Linux安装
1.下载包到Linux
1.1.在linux新建一个自己的目录用于存放安装包,命令如下:
mkdir /opt/dev
1.2在MangoDB官网找到下载链接
1.2.1 官网地址如下:
https://www.mongodb.com
1.2.2选择下载配置
1.找到下载入口,如下图:
2.选择对应的配置信息
- 注意:liunx系统没有外网就下载到本地上传到Linux
3.使用链接下载,命令如下:
wget https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-rhel80-5.0.7.tgz
4.如下图则下载完毕
2.安装MongoDB到linux
2.1解压缩mongodb的包,命令如下:
tar -zxvf mongodb-linux-x86_64-rhel80-5.0.7.tgz
2.2将解压完毕的包移动到服务系列的目录(根据自己的习惯存放)
- 注意:相当于把mongodb放在/opt/server/目录下,并且新起名为mongodb
mv mongodb-linux-x86_64-rhel80-5.0.7 ../server/mongodb
- mongodb目录如下图所示:
2.3新建两个目录
- 第一个:用于存储数据
mkdir -p /mongodb/single/data/db
- 第二个:用于存储日志
mkdir -p /mongodb/single/log
2.4新建并设置配置文件
vi /monodb/single/mongod.conf
- 参数配置内容以YML形式如下:
systemLog: #MongoDB发送所有日志输出的目标指定为文件
destination: file #mongod或mongos应向其发送所有诊断日志记录的日志文件的路径
path: "/opt/server/mongodb/single/log/mongod.log"
logAppend: true #当mongos或mongod实例重启时,mongos或mongod会将条目附加到现有日志文件的末尾
storage: #mongod 实例存储其数据的目录storage.dbPath设置仅适用于mongod
dbPath: "/opt/server/mongodb/single/data/db"
journal: #启用或禁用持久性日志以确保数据文件保持有效和可恢复
enabled: true
processManagement:
fork: true #启动在后台运行mongos或mongod进行的守护进程模式
net:
bindIp: 0.0.0.0 #绑定端口号
port: 27017 #绑定端口号
- 如下图配置内容,保存即可!安装完毕,后继续进行启动验证…
3.启动并验证
- 第一步:进入bin目录
- 第二步:输入启动命令,如下:
./mongod -f ../single/mongod.conf
- 第三步:观察输出 successfully表示启动成功
- 第四步:使用mongodb自带客户端验证
如上:进入bin目录,使用命令:mongo命令启动再带客户端正常,说明服务器连接正常。
如下:可输入show dbs 查询mongodb自带三个库
4.使用官网提供MongonDB Compass客户端连接
- 第一步:下载连接如下:
https://www.mongodb.com/try/download/tools
- 第二步:选择windows配置下载到本地
- 第三步:解压缩下载到的包,进入目录启动即可
- 第四步:连接成功,如下图所示:
皆上流程所示,mongodb安装完成,如果对您有用请点击收藏。